Adenosine 5′-diphosphate sodium salt
Adenosine 5′-diphosphate sodium salt (CAS: 20398-34-9), with the molecular formula C10H15N5O10P2, is a crucial adenine nucleotide. It plays a vital role in energy storage and nucleic acid metabolism, serving as a precursor to ATP. This compound also significantly influences platelet activation through its interactions with specific ADP receptors.

| Application | Adenosine 5′-diphosphate (ADP) is an adenine nucleotide involved in energy storage and nucleic acid metabolism via its conversion into ATP by ATP synthases. ADP affects platelet activation through its interaction with ADP receptors P2Y1, P2Y12 and P2X1. Upon its conversion to adenosine by ecto-ADPases, platelet activation is inhibited via adenosine receptors. |
